Position Summary
The Production/Rehang Operator position is responsible for monitoring equipment performance, making adjustments, and performing changeovers. Setting up and shutting down machines in the assigned area is also required.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ities- Monitors equipment, making adjustments to ensure quality and productivity standards are maintained, while minimizing rework and downtime.
- Prepares the work area for start‑up, changeovers, and shutdown (including selecting appropriate programs).
- Maintains records and conducts periodic checks as directed.
- Provides supplies needed for the operation of the machine/line (e.g., film, packaging, PPE, etc.).
- Communicates with team members by notifying maintenance, supervisor/leads, and production associates as needed.
- Understands and performs duties of the assigned line, assists team members on the line, and helps with rework or training of team members as needed.
- Completes basic preventive maintenance checklist on equipment.
- Assists with other line equipment, making necessary adjustments as needed.
- Assists in other departments as needed for basic, routine machine operation, and break coverage.
- Cleans and organizes the work area.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
- Shows flexibility of working hours based on daily needs of the department.
- May be asked to rotate to positions between departments or positions that require data collection and recordkeeping.
- Observe & enforce all company personnel, quality, safety, and food safety policies.
- Maintain a positive work atmosphere by acting and communicating in a manner that promotes effective, cooperative teamwork with customers, clients, coworkers, and leadership.
- Participate in process improvement and problem solving utilizing continuous improvement and rational thinking methodologies, recognize and act on incidents and safety risks, and consistently enforce safe work habits throughout the organization.
Skills and Abilities
- Ability to add, subtract, multiply, and divide.
- Ability to solve problems involving a few concrete variables in standardized situations.
- Ability to work in cool temperatures (around 40 degrees).
- Ability to stand and use hands for 8‑11 hours per day.
- Ability to multitask quickly.
- Ability to perform light maintenance on equipment.
- Pallet jack license or willingness to acquire one.
- Authorization to perform LOTO (Lock Out/Tag Out) or willingness to acquire authorization.
- Six months to a year of food or production experience required.
- Must be a team player and willing to work close to other employees at some stations (less than 3 feet apart).
- Must have good communication skills.
- Capable of learning and remembering product specifications.
- Capable of lifting and carrying 40+ pounds.
- Good hand and eye coordination required.
- High School diploma or G.E.D. preferred.
- Intermediate analytical skills preferred.
- Basic computer skills or strong willingness to learn preferred.
- Desire for continuous improvement preferred.
- Flex 2 Operator—ability to become HACCP certified.
